UKTV commissions Red planet pictures to develop network’s first original drama series

Watch

Leading UK independent production company, Red Planet Pictures, revealed today that it is developing a new, 10-part drama series for UKTV's flagship entertainment channel, Watch.

The ambitious series, the broadcaster?s first original drama commission, was announced by founder of Red Planet Pictures, Tony Jordan, who unveiled details of the supernatural thriller.

Legion is a bold and exciting new drama series which follows criminologist Nathan Jones who, after learning the devastating news that his 10 year old daughter has an inoperable brain tumour, scours the globe in search of a possible treatment. His desperate quest for a cure brings him to the very edge of humanity, forcing him into one last throw of the dice, making a deal with the Devil to save the life of his child.

When Nathan realises that he's been tricked, he undertakes to renegotiate his contract by fighting the Devil?s work on earth wherever he finds it, ultimately leading him to a startling discovery - a revelation which will change the world as we know it forever.

Legion will be the first original drama commission for UKTV's Watch as the network looks to bolster its already successful slate of original UK entertainment and factual commissions.

Once co-production partners are on board and the location for the shoot is confirmed, Legion will go into production. Red Planet Pictures and Peter Smith of Cineflix are currently approaching international partners and will be taking the opportunity next month to meet a number of broadcasters interested in the ambitious project at MIPCOM.

UKTV is a multi-award-winning media company that reaches over 42 million viewers per month. The network has recently bolstered its commissioning output and its first original sitcom, You, Me & Them, starring Anthony Head and Lindsay Duncan, is due to air on its comedy channel Gold next month. In addition, at the Guardian Edinburgh International Television Festival in August, UKTV's Controller Emma Tennant announced Crackanory, a brand new series for its popular entertainment channel Dave that puts a satirical and twisted grown-up spin on ?story time?.

Red Planet Pictures is one of the few truly independent production companies in the UK and has two dramas currently in production: a third series of hit Caribbean detective drama Death in Paradise and new, thrilling six-part crime series about a clandestine police department who go to any lengths to bring the criminal elite to justice, By Any Means - both of which will air on BBC One. The company has also recently announced two new commissions for BBC One: a five-part drama, The Great War, part of the BBC?s programming around the centenary of the First World War; and Dickensian, an ambitious new drama production for the BBC which will be populated by the vivid characters from Dickens? classic novels.

RED PLANET PICTURES:

Tony Jordan set up Red Planet Pictures in 2005 as a uniquely writer led, creatively inspiring, drama house. It was conceived to make popular intelligent drama - the type of shows that cemented Tony's reputation as series creator and show runner.

2010's multi-award winning THE NATIVITY received both critical acclaim and commercial success. 2011 saw the arrival of DEATH IN PARADISE ? Caribbean-set murder mysteries starring Ben Miller and broadcast on the BBC and FTV in France. This proved a huge success, selling to over 140 territories. 2013 has seen an even more successful second series, drawing the highest midweek ratings for any new drama show on BBC One.

Red Planet Pictures is currently in production for season three of DEATH IN PARADISE and for new BBC One series BY ANY MEANS about a clandestine police department that, when the legal system fails, go to any lengths to bring the criminal elite to justice. The indie is also in pre-production on a new epic BBC drama THE GREAT WAR, a centrepiece production in the broadcasters? programming around the centenary of WWI, and new long-running drama series DICKENSIAN, also for the BBC. The original production will bring the world of Dickens to life in a drama populated by the vivid characters from his classic books.
